n8n-nodes-soaprequest
A community node for making soap requests with n8n, the workflow automation tool. This node allows
you to not worry about the soap boilerplate in your n8n workflows.
Features
- request: Send a soap request.
- interpolate: In order to not hardcode credentials in either the soap:Body or soap:Header, you
can use the
interpolate
function. This allows you to use {{ $credentials.username }} and {{
$credentials.password }} in your template and it will be interpolated with the selected SOAP API
credentials.
Installation
To install the node, follow these steps:
- Navigate to your n8n installation directory.
- Install the node package:
npm install n8n-nodes-soaprequest
- Start or restart your n8n instance.
Configuration
Before using the SOAP Request node, you need to configure the Soap API credentials in n8n.
- Go to the n8n Credentials section.
- Add new credentials and select "Soap API".
- Enter your credentials.
- Save the credentials.
Usage
Once the credentials are set up, you can use the SOAP Request
node in your workflows.
- Add the
SOAP Request
node: Drag and drop the SOAP Request
node into your workflow. - Select credentials to connect with : Choose the credentials you configured in the previous
step.
- Configure Parameters: set the right parameters for your soap request.
- Execute Workflow: Run your workflow to make a soap request.
License
This project is licensed under the MIT License. See
the LICENSE file for details.